Principal Process Engineer - Madrid, España - Wood Plc
Descripción
Overview / Responsibilities:
Wood is currently looking for a Principal Process Engineer to participate in our Basic design projects for international clients across the refining sector.
Among his / her responsibilities:
- Act as process project manager reporting to the project manager
- Ensure that process engineering design activities are executed following client and Wood standards and procedures to schedule and budget as advised by the project manager
- Be accountability for the calculations, data sheets, narrative documents and engineering diagrams prepared for the project by the team members
- Lead, coordinate and motivate teams, plan work, and provide clear technical guidance
- Ensure the delivery of challenging project and client targets using technical knowledge and decisionmaking skills
- Provide technical expertise and support to the project manager to any business activity as required.
- Mentoring, coaching and development of junior staff
- Keep up to date with the latest technical developments in your fields of expertise
- Review and audit process engineering activity on projects and support internal development and continuous improvement activity as required
- Ensure WOOD and Client health, safety, environmental and quality procedures are followed and that a high standard of safety is achieved in all associated work
Skills / Qualifications:
- Chemical Engineering degree
- Technical knowledge of Oil & Gas and Refining process units (Crude and Vacuum, Delayed Coking, Hydrotreating, Hydrocracking, FCC, Alkylation, SRU, SWS, Utilities & Offsites, etc)
- Customer focus and ability to respond to customer needs whilst achieving project and corporate objectives
- Leading skills
- From 10 to 15 years of proven experience in process design engineering, working at different steps of a project starting from Basic Engineering, FEED and EPC (Greenfield / Revamp projects).
- Further experience will be an added advantage
- Proficient in technical software like ASPEN HYSYS, PRO-II, PROMAX, ASPENFLARE SYSTEM ANALYSER
- Excellent command of Spanish and English languages
- Holding a valid permit to live and work in Spain is required
- Availability to join in one month
